Sec. 260.011. EXCLUSION PROHIBITED. If an entity meets the requirements established by a county or municipality under this chapter, the entity may not be excluded from a residential area by zoning ordinances or similar regulations.

Legislative History

Redesignated from Health and Safety Code, Chapter 254 by Acts 2011, 82nd Leg., R.S., Ch. 91 (S.B. 1303 ), Sec. 27.001(28), eff. September 1, 2011.
